## Authentication

Heads up for release: Wispcast's websocket layer supports permessage-deflate, but we ship it off by default — the CPU hit on small frames isn't worth the ~18% bandwidth savings for our telemetry payloads. Flip `ws.compress=true` only for the bulk-export channel. Either way, every socket upgrade needs an authenticated handshake, compressed or not. For smoke-testing the release build against staging, use the bearer token below.

login token, bagug-kafop: eyJhbGciOiJIUzI1NiIsInR5cCI6IkpXVCJ9.eyJzdWIiOiIcMLov2In0.Z5RLDIfp

# Break-Glass: Catalog Cache Invalidation

Scope: the Pinrow product catalog at Veldstone Retail. If stale prices persist after a purge and the Hollowmere invalidation queue is wedged, use break-glass to flush the edge tier directly. Contractors: get verbal sign-off from the catalog lead first. Steps: open the Hollowmere admin shell, select emergency-flush, confirm the tenant, and run it once — repeated flushes thrash the origin. Access is logged and expires after 20 minutes. Unseal the admin shell with the passphrase below.

recovery phrase for kahop-tajog: istix-casvan

Subject: MarkForge key rotation this Thursday

Hey all — quick heads up for the sync: we're rotating the credential the MarkForge rendering pipeline uses to call the internal Snippetry service. Old key dies Thursday noon. Update your local configs before then or previews will 401. To save everyone a ticket, the new Snippetry key is right below.

service key, fawip-bajef: kto11_Qt5wZK9vdNC

## Service Accounts — StormFan Alert Fan-Out

The fan-out worker authenticates to the internal dispatch tier using the svc-stormfan account. Rotate quarterly; scopes are limited to publish-only on alert topics. If deliveries stall during your shift, verify the worker is using the current credential, reproduced below for reference.

API key for kaweg-hahif: kto4_rAjZ